#67983d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67983d is composed of 40.4% red, 59.6%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 92.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.7% and a lightness of 41.8%. #67983d color hex could be obtained by blending #ceff7a with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#67983d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#67983d has RGB values of R:103, G:152,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6789181.

Shades and Tints of #67983d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080c05 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#67983d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6f66 is the less saturated color, while #63d104 is the most saturated one.
